Much to her delight, though, Rucker has made some remarkably brilliant strides as the proud owner and chief executive officer of Charmed by Rucker, an up-and-coming professional styling service that is starting to become a fixture throughout Houston’s massive Metroplex.
“I already was styling and, of course, I’d get compliments on what I wear,” Rucker, a native of Houma, Louisiana, told Making Headline News during an exclusive interview.
A unique and credible business she started in June 2017, Charmed by Rucker initially began as a hobby, of sorts, for Rucker, a alumna of the University of Houston. Consequently, the favorable feedback she garnered had eventually prompted a gallery of friends and family members to compile referrals on behalf of Rucker, whose hobby had quickly blossomed into a full-blown styling and image consulting business.

A business that caters to individuals from newborns and up, Charmed by Rucker has serviced mostly models for on-set photo shoots, entrepreneurs, children, and educators, just to name a few.
